Output 62a24fe473ad311ee53ea6c42e7d41e7b72619fb55f4c426856c86834a807eba:29

value
1398714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c0a8965263a612d903969af67984dc234a8c42 OP_EQUAL
address
3NBQ5fU9wjMNt9FGvxA7HrvM4dgPJVbq22
transaction
62a24fe473ad311ee53ea6c42e7d41e7b72619fb55f4c426856c86834a807eba
confirmations
285324
spent
true